Mourinho is now the coach of Madrid: 15 million, meetings, and uncertainty in the dressing room due to the market

Updated

The Portuguese arrived in the capital on Tuesday afternoon and is already preparing for the Madrid preseason after Benfica's official announcement. He met at a hotel in the city center with Mendes, José Ángel Sánchez, and Juni Calafat

Jose Mourinho is now here in exchange for 15 million euros. Benfica made it official through a statement. 13 years after his 'goodbye', the Portuguese coach landed back in the Spanish capital on Tuesday afternoon to reclaim the coaching position at Real Madrid. What the Portuguese had been dreaming of for months, fueled by the crisis at the white club and the comparison with Carlo Ancelotti's arrival in 2021, has happened. While the Italian received an unexpected call from José Ángel Sánchez, Mourinho's return was facilitated by a series of direct clashes between his former club, Benfica, and Real Madrid in the Champions League, his strong relationship with Florentino Pérez, and the doubts within the Madrid team's management regarding the choice of the new coach. After the era of the young Xabi Alonso and Álvaro Arbeloa, Madrid is once again entering friendly territory... And uncertainty about the market is growing in the dressing room.

The Chamartín club has activated Mourinho's release clause by paying 15 million euros to Benfica, and the Portuguese coach has signed for the next three years. After the Portuguese club officially announced his departure, he will be presented in the coming days and will begin planning the team's preseason this same week, with daily meetings. The first meeting took place on Tuesday afternoon at a hotel in the center of Madrid with Mendes, José Ángel Sánchez, the club's general director, and Juni Calafat, the head scout. On the agenda were discussions about Julián Álvarez and the stars on the team's wish list.

There will be no traditional North American tour that Madrid has done in recent years, and the players will go directly to the training ground after their holidays. Initially, the core of the first team will start training at the training ground in mid-July, still during the World Cup, and the 10 World Cup players will join at the end of the month after their days off following the tournament.

The La Liga season will start for the whites on the weekend of August 22, a week later than the rest of the clubs that do not have 10 or more internationals, giving Mourinho more time to prepare for the start.

The Portuguese coach arrives in Madrid with his trusted core. Joao Tralhao, his right-hand man, the analyst Roberto Merella, and the fitness coach Antonio Dias. It remains to be seen what this means for Antonio Pintus, the head of physical preparation for the first team during the Ancelotti and Arbeloa era.

There are still uncertainties in his coaching staff, such as the identity of his assistant coach. In his first stint in Madrid, it was Aitor Karanka, and in recent days, the possibility of Pepe, a former player of the white club, has gained strength, although it is not yet confirmed.

Mourinho returns with hunger but also with many more years of experience under his belt. With more calmness. Less combative. Those who know him best admit that this will be noticeable in his day-to-day interactions with the press, although not so much with the squad. The group expects a coach who is firm but also approachable. Someone who demands from them but also defends them. All this in a dressing room that is experiencing some uncertainty in these early weeks of the transfer market. Many players are on the verge of leaving or uncertain about their future, and others are waiting for the club's moves in the market to determine their fate.

Konaté and Dumfries will arrive after the World Cup, and Florentino promised to make an offer of 150 million for a galactic player this week, but much of the news about the squad will revolve around departures, an aspect where Mourinho and the club are in agreement. Hence the nervousness emanating from the team. There is a group of players unsure about their role under the new coach and awaiting a conversation with him to clarify their feelings.
